REPAIR BROKEN EYEGLASSES WITH SUPERGLUE AND BAKING SODA

  • I use items found in my wife's cosmetic drawer to fix broken eyeglass frames. The repair will be strong and long-lasting, as well as saving you money and time. As you can see in the video, I repaired these in a little over three minutes. Hope this hack helps those of you who wear glasses, or have broken sunglasses.

    Works in certain cases not all depends on material like on this guy's cheap ish injection molded nylon based frame it does work I have done it myself many of times to help people out but it's definitely not good as new also it does take a technically minded skilled person to do a good job but for a quick fix it works

Not only do frame and lens materials contributing factors but location of the break must be considered as well. I prefer slow set two part epoxy in general but adhesives are also available that have a little flexibility making them less prone to cracking. Overall cyanoacrylate glues are the worst choice. However, as you pointed out, using ANY adhesives is only a temporary solution and in no way could it be considered “good as new”
